Responsibilities:

  • Performing mammography exams on all patients for the purpose of breast cancer detection while delivering exceptional patient care
  • Maintaining compliance with hospital and departmental policies and procedures
  • Evaluating images for quality and facility standards
  • Maintaining equipment according to Infection Control procedures and performing quality control procedures as requested
  • Following facilities quality assurance guidelines and maintaining patient confidentiality/HIPAA
  • Performing screening and diagnostic mammography imaging procedures according to department procedures and protocols
  • Adjusting equipment and instructing patient to eliminate imaging artifacts
  • Evaluating imaging results for positioning and technical accuracy
  • Informing physicians of preliminary findings as requested according to department guidelines/procedures
  • Distributing completed test results to physicians and service providers according to department guidelines/procedures
  • Maintaining patient charts, entering diagnosis and billing codes, logging data into patient information systems and updating file systems for tests performed according to department guidelines/procedures
  • Appropriate cleaning and sterilizing equipment and work space
  • Recognizing equipment malfunctions and readjusting equipment or writing/calling in for repair
  • Instructing patients in pretest preparation, answering questions, and explaining procedures according to department guidelines/procedures
  • Maintaining current Permits to Practice in all states in which services are performed
  • Performing equipment quality checks and troubleshooting problems. Calling for service and notifying all pertinent team members
  • Following quality assurance guidelines and maintaining patient confidentiality
  • Performing additional duties as required

Experience Required for Your Success

Required Experience:
  • Technologist background with a minimum of 1 year mammography clinical experience
RequiredLicense/Certification:
  • Valid ARRT license, registered in Mammography
  • Valid CPR certificate, as needed
  • Valid state license
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Strong communication skills both written and verbal needed
  • Interact with client personnel and team members in an autonomous, responsible, professional and ethical manner
  • Must be flexible, reliable and demonstrate sound judgment and initiative
  • Strong positive change agent

In this role the successful candidate will function as a Mammography Technologist in performing examinations of patients of all ages for the purpose of assisting in the diagnosis of patient illness. The Mammography Technologist interacts and communicates professionally with physicians, patients, family members and team members. The Mammography Technologist must be able to function independently but also work collaboratively with the Nursing and Ancillary staff members to provide exceptional patient care.
